SUMMARY OF CHAPTER 9

In this chapter 9, " DIRECT AND INDIRECT COMMUNICATION STRATEGIES " , The purpose of this chapter is to demonstrate what is mean by direct and indirect communication strategies? , Their different types, components and steps etc.
Direct communication strategy is that which states important points quickly, usually in the beginning of message and indirect communicatin strategy is that which delays important points until after they have been explained. There are different types of direct messages they are; request for information, claims and adjustments, directive and policy statement, good news, good will etc. And the components of direct messages are; mainidea, justification , explanation ,details and courtesy close. There are also different types of indirect messages they are; refusals/ denials, collections, social refusals .And the goal of indirect persuasive message are; to generate attention, to arouse interest,to arouse desire, to reduce resistance and to push for action.

CHAPTER 3 SUMMARY

Before defining a message, we must first define our goal. However many people choose to start by putting out a message without ever considering how its going to affect our target goals.
In this chapter "Creating effective messages" what i learned is why it is necessary to make an effective messages and how we can make it. Well, there are eight steps of communication design . First step is to map out message goals. There are two types of goal they are primary and secondary.Second step is to evaluate your audience.Business audience, public audience, and intimate audience are its types.Third steps is to shape message content. Fourth step is to select channels.Audience, speed, effect, appeal etc areits channels.fifth steps is to acquire resources by researching.Resources can be time, personnel, outsourcing, research, money (capital). Sixth steps is to generate source credibility. It should be relaibility, dynamism, similarity and competence and last seventh steps is to eliminate design flaws which is to eliminate unnecessary information.
If we follow all these steps we can definitely create our message effective which will let our audience to pay more attention
